Too much posts to read but I will say this and maybe it will help, my brz was totaled a few months back and yes I did pay a california premium on it of 5k. When the insurance company valued my car they valued it at 26k instead of the 32,150 that I paid for it. So I would be down 8k... My car was 3 weeks old with 2,300mi. The total loss agent wont listen to me no matter what when I told him the selling price is much higher. He told me when he looked at california subaru websites they were listed at 27k etc but he doesnt realize when you go to the dealers there is a piece of paper that brings it to "market value" I had to go to my agent and have him call the total loss agent and tell him to call california dealers for him to give me the correct amount back. I ended up only losing around 200 from the accident. It was a PITA to get the correct amount back and I was pissed for the longest time. They realized that in california this car sells for more and now they're going to adjust for that now unless your insurance company hasnt been notified or wants to screw you over. Just bitch if theyre gonna screw you over and bring up BBB.
